Key features of the transfer station consist of a scale house, two scales, a transfer station building with a three-bay tipping floor, and a separate small load area where residents can deposit waste In addition, there are designated areas outside to receive used appliances, tires, and yard waste

See the Collection Station page for details What type of trash is accepted? Bagged household waste and yard waste Bags no larger than 33 gallon What are the fees charged to dispose waste? One ticket punch per bag Ten and twenty punch tickets are available for $10 and $20 respectively It is $1 per bag Do you take lead acid (car) batteries?

Find A Recycling Drop-Off Center What Can I Recycle At Recycling Drop-Off Centers? Newspapers Brown Paper Bags Magazines Catalogs Telephone Soft Cover Books Junk Mail Envelopes (all types) Paper Paperboard (cereal tissue boxes) Cardboard Glass Bottles Jars (any color) Aseptic Containers and Cartons Metal Cans (tin steel aluminum) Plastic Bottles, Jugs Jar As well as, Household Batteries
